But the shatterproof display in itself could be enough to appeal to those who want a rough-and-tough phone that doesn’t skimp on any other aspects either.Update (Apr 19th): The Moto X Force is now available at Rs 34,999 and 37,999 for the 32GB and 64GB editions respectively. With this price tag, the smartphone is a more attractive proposition and also stands out from the competition. You can also go for the Google Nexus 6P (review) in case you want a large-screen experience along with the latest Android iteration, which is available for almost Rs 10,000 lower.The Motorola Moto X Force isn’t for every one – and that’s apparent from its USP as well as its pricing. In comparison, the Samsung Galaxy S7 and its slightly pricier sibling, the S7 edge (review) offer more features. The phablet misses out on premium features such as optical image stabilisation for the camera, a fingerprint scanner and doesn’t have dual-SIM support either.

For your money, you get an unbreakable smartphone with powerful guts, impressive battery life and a decent pair of snappers.However, it’s hard to justify its pricing apart from the fact that you get a smashproof screen. Its 32GB edition will cost Rs 49,999, while the 64-gig version will set you back by Rs 53,999.
